The perimeter of the rectangular playing field is 564 yards. The length of the field is 8 yards less than quadruple the width. What are the dimensions of the playing​ field?

It is given in the question that

The perimeter of the rectangular playing field is 564 yards. The length of the field is 8 yards less than quadruple the width.

Let the width be x yards. SO length is


=(4x-8) yards

And perimeter is the sum of all sides. That is


x+4x-8+x+4x-8 = 564 \\ 10x -16= 564 \\ 10x = 580 \\ x=58

Therefore the width is 58 yards. And the length is


= 4(58)-8 = 224 yards
